Robby is haunted by traumatic flashes of the day his senior, Dr. Adamson, died right in front of him. Seeing him struggle to maintain a professional facade while clearly breaking down internally added a profound layer of depth to his character.
Jack’s pivotal decision regarding the bison was triggered by a seemingly minor side plot involving a burial plot. It served as a reminder of how small, personal realizations can lead to massive professional shifts.
The storyline featuring Helen’s father offered a strikingly relatable look at the "limbo" of grief. After an emotional final goodbye, the father survives for several more days, creating a strangely uncomfortable and emotionally exhausting atmosphere that many viewers found poignantly realistic.
